Comment utiliser les fonctions intégrées de PHP pour traiter des chaînes
Introduction
PHP fournit une multitude de fonctions intégrées pour traiter les chaînes, qui offrent de puissantes capacités de manipulation de texte. Dans cet article, nous explorerons différentes manières d'utiliser ces fonctions pour manipuler des chaînes.
Catégories de fonctions de chaîne
PHP fournit des fonctions de traitement de chaîne couvrant les catégories principales suivantes :
Communément utilisé fonctions de chaîne
Voici quelques-unes des fonctions de chaîne PHP les plus couramment utilisées :
Cas pratique
Illustrons comment utiliser ces fonctions pour traiter des caractères à travers un cas pratique Chaîne :
Question : Extraire une liste de mots de un texte et classez-les par ordre alphabétique.
Solution :
// 方案 1:使用 explode() 和 asort() 函数 $text = "Hello world! This is a test."; $words = explode(" ", $text); asort($words); // 方案 2:使用 preg_split() 和 sort() 函数 $words = preg_split("/[\s,]+/", $text); sort($words); // 输出单词列表 echo implode(", ", $words);
Sortie :
Hello, This, a, is, test, world!
Autres fonctions utiles
En plus des fonctions mentionnées ci-dessus, PHP fournit également des fonctions de traitement de chaînes plus utiles, notamment :
Conclusion
Grâce aux fonctions de chaîne intégrées de PHP, nous pouvons facilement effectuer une série de tâches de manipulation de texte. En comprenant le but de ces fonctions et comment les combiner, nous pouvons écrire du code efficace et maintenable pour traiter les chaînes.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!